- Scope and Content
- Photograph of Burnaby's Agricultural Exhibit at New Westminster. Vegetables, fruit, preserves, flowers, and plants are on display inside a building. There is electric lighting. A sign above the display reads, "Burnaby." A sign above a container on the lower left reads, "Ginseng / Grown in Lozells District by Mr. Romer."

- Scope and Content
- Photograph of Burnaby North High School Junior Basketball team and champions of the Wilson Cup. The team and coaches are gathered together with their championship trophy for a group photograph. Ray Fleming is identified second from right in the front row sitting next to the trophy with a basket ball balanced on top with the words "BNHS / Jr. Champs / 1929" painted on it. Other team members include J.Gemmel, W. Auld, D. Wright, F. Parker and A. Lawson. The team beat out Duke of Connaught High School of New Westminster in the championship game, 10-8 as the final score.

- Scope and Content
- Item is a scrapbook documenting the families of husband and wife John Ivan Yanko and Leida Doria "Lillian Doris" (Carman) Yanko. The scrapbook consists of ca. 255 (mostly black and white, some colour) photographs from the family, with captions that identify the subjects and locations of the photographs. Included in the album are plastic sleeves housing textual records including: correspondence; a baptism certificate; and the title page of another scrapbook.
